Moto Morini 350 Kanguro - 1986 Specifications and Reviews
The 1986 Moto Morini 350 Kanguro is a lightweight enduro bike designed for trail riders seeking manageable performance and handling. Its compact 344cc V-twin engine produces 27 horsepower while keeping weight to just 150kg, making it ideal for amateur off-road enthusiasts and smaller riders navigating challenging terrain.
